Output 6ab68dc3240aa6647c263537b9a66dd0dfd6cc57ac9831ad5a5cb57fcbd174c6:3

value
578900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ba197475e79d6629da6c62e20a679b90041bfc0 OP_EQUAL
address
32kWwBu8ndew6tLvdvo6QZRXmbccoPYVYk
transaction
6ab68dc3240aa6647c263537b9a66dd0dfd6cc57ac9831ad5a5cb57fcbd174c6
spent
true